Golf division proposes modest fee increases to fund capital backlog after record play
Summary
Salt Lake City’s golf division proposed small fee increases across six municipal courses to capture revenue after a record year and fund capital projects (irrigation, cart paths, restrooms). Staff projects roughly $1 million in additional revenue and outlined $15 million in near‑term projects and $33 million of unfunded improvements.
